Mutton Chop Miniatures
![]() |
| Lord Cirenchester |
From their announcement:
Mutton Chop Miniatures is the sculpting ramblings of Paul Hicks. It is a collection inspired by the spirit of the 1930s and Heath Robinson styled contraptions. You won’t find any large ranges of historical themed armies here. You will find figures that are full of character and great for skirmishing or adding flavour to a themed army.

Soldier who fought off 30 Taliban — Alone

Sergeant Dipprasad Pun, 31, of the 1st Battalion the Royal Gurkha Rifles holds his Conspicuous Gallantry Cross, after it was presented to him by QueenElizabeth II at Buckingham Palace in central London June 1 , 2011. Sergeant Pun defeated more than 30 Taliban fighters single-handedly during an attack on his checkpoint in Helmand province, Afghanistan in September 2010. The award is second only to the Victoria Cross, the highest military decoration for armed forces of the Commonwealth.
